Le Charme Suites is a new staycation jewel in Subic. Since I wanted to discover and try places that people haven’t gone to yet, I purposely chose Le Charme Suites. I booked a Deluxe King Room for Php 4,899.00 via Booking.com.
I took a ride from Victory Liner Terminal in Cubao to Olongapo (Php 207.00). The route I should have taken was supposed to be SCTEX, but I was late by thirty minutes, so I had no choice but to take the Pampanga Route.
We were dropped off at Victory Liner Terminal in Olongapo where I had to take a taxi worth Php 250.00 (not recommended) since tricycles and jeepneys were not allowed to enter there. Pros:
- The best part of my staycation was my experience with the staff. They were very polite and accommodating, not to mention good-looking.
- The pool was instagrammable with a stunning view of the sky.
- I had everything I needed in my room; I felt like royalty for once. My three favorite things in the room were the TV that had a movie channel (which I enjoyed a lot and maybe spent half of my staycation on my bed watching them), the bathtub, and, of course, the king-sized bed. The room was actually too big for one person, but why not try to live like someone’s majesty for once?
- The Game of Thrones display in the lobby is a must-see for all GoT lovers (but I think it’s for their Halloween special only).
- It’s just a walk away from shoe stores and fast food restaurants, so shopping was no problem.
Cons:
- The food needed to improve, though, which I wrote in my feedback.
- It’s far from the beach. Commuting to popular places took time.
- Since Le Charme Suites is new, many rooms are still under renovation.
Add-ons to my trip:
- The Subic Fiesta Carnival is just a ride away from Le Charme Suites. Compared to other carnivals, this one’s a little big. It had like six (or more, I think) rides. I was even surprised it had a cable car! (Unfortunately, this is up to January only.)
- Near Victory Liner is Yena’s Kitchen. They are serving an eight- to ten-inch taco for less than Php 200.00.
